The funding project

Enabling Networks Münsterland is a regional collaborative project that combines the key potentials of Münsterland in the field of innovation with the aim of structurally and sustainably improving innovation promotion and innovation marketing.

These special potentials for Münsterland result from a pronounced regional research competence and the highly specialised, mostly medium-sized, economic structure. The focus of the project is to improve the networking of these two innovation drivers and to work together on innovations.

The Enabling Networks project turns target groups into actors and forms a new interface for regional innovation promotion between companies, science, business development, politics and the public. The overarching goal is to promote regional innovation structures by establishing and consolidating networks and cooperations in the five innovation competence fields (IKF) of the Münsterland. These were identified in a regional environment analysis as part of the predecessor project "Enabling Innovation Münsterland".

The Enabling Networks project consists of two main packages of measures: The first provides for the establishment and implementation of entrepreneurial think tanks in all innovation competence fields. These pursue the intention of developing future strategies and suggestions for regional innovation promotion in the form of recommendations for action for regional innovation promotion and the political environment. The second package of measures networks companies and higher education institutions in the region and provides impulses for advancing innovations through low-threshold regional technology scouting in the innovation competence fields of the Münsterland. This dialogue-oriented provision of information can then be linked to cooperation opportunities and recommendations for action. These can also be integrated into the future strategies of the think tanks.

Project data

Project title Enabling Networks Münsterland
Project partner
  • Lead partner (coordination) Münsterland e.V.
  • Technology Promotion Münster
  • Economic Development Coesfeld
  • Economic Development Agency District of Borken
  • Steinfurt District Economic Development
  • Economic Development Agency District of Warendorf
  • AFO WWU Münster
  • TAFH Münster GmbH of the Münster University of Applied Sciences
  • Münster University of Applied Sciences (Institute for Energy and Process Technology and Institute for Infrastructure ∙ Water ∙ Resources ∙ Environment)
  • University of Westphalia
  • Society for Bioanalytics Münster e.V.
  • Surface Network NRW e.V.
Total volume

2,350,915 euros

Funding

80 % funding
Grant from the State of NRW using funds from
the European
Regional Development Fund (ERDF) 2014 - 2020

Implementation period 01.09.2019 – 31.08.2022
Objectives
  • Networking of innovation promotion in the Münsterland region
  • Promotion of the five regional innovation competence fields (Digital Solutions, Life Sciences, Engineering Pro, Engineering Pro, Materials and Surfaces, Sustainable Eco) through the establishment and consolidation of networks
  • Development of future scenarios and recommendations for action for the further development of the regional innovation competence fields
  • Establishment of a specific form of technology scouting for small and medium-sized enterprises
  • Location marketing "Münsterland Innovation Region
Target groups
  • Company representatives/business representatives/managing directors
  • Research and development
  • People interested in innovation
Measures
  • Establishment of entrepreneurial "think tanks" for the strategic further development of one innovation competence field each
  • Carrying out innovation scouting trips with the think tanks
  • Holding events on the innovation scouting trips with the think tanks
  • Testing of technology scouting in the five innovation competence fields
